Description: vRealize Code Stream is a release automation platform by VMware that provides an automated software release management solution. It helps in creating flexible release pipelines to automate application releases across hybrid cloud environments.

Description: Bamboo is a continuous integration and delivery tool that allows developers to automate building, testing and deploying applications. It provides visibility into builds and releases, integrates with other Atlassian products, and has flexible build plans.
